Airframe & Powerplant Mechanics

Description:
STS Technical Services is hiring A&P Mechanics in Oscoda, Michigan.

Job Duties & Requirements:
A&P’s to perform hangar and line maintenance on mostly Boeing Commercial Aircraft
Kalitta’s own fleet consists of 747s, 767s and 777s
Mechanics do not need to be current or have an A&P, but they must have experience if they do not have a valid A&P
The job duties of an A&P mechanic vary from preventive maintenance to repairs
A mechanic makes routine inspections, documents inspections and repairs, performs scheduled maintenance and runs tests after making repairs or performing maintenance
Job duties may vary based on which part of the plane is being worked on
A mechanic working on the exterior of a plane may be fixing a broken wing, repairing paint or securing a door so it seals properly
An A&P mechanic inspects, services and repairs airplanes to ensure they’re operating correctly and safely
A mechanic is responsible for ensuring that airplanes get regular maintenance and that any problems are fixed correctly
Mechanics may work on different parts of an aircraft, such as the engine, landing gear, brakes and pumps
A mechanic working on the engine may be changing the oil, replacing belts or repairing a broken part
An A&P mechanic must know and follow all regulations set by the FAA. FAA regulations govern the maintenance schedules, inspections and repairs made to airplanes. The FAA conducts regular checks on equipment and ensures regulations are being met.
